Effects of ions and ionic channel activators or blockers on release of α-MSH from perifused rat hypothalamic slices

DT Bunel, C Delbende, C Blasquez, S Jégou… - Molecular Brain …, 1990 - Elsevier
The involvement of sodium and chloride ions in the process of α-melanocyte-stimulating
hormone (α-MSH) release from hypothalamic neurons was investigated using perifused rat
hypothalamic slices. Three different stimuli were found to increase α-MSH release from
hypothalamic slices: high K+ concentration (50 mM), veratridine (50 μM), and the Na+ K+-
ATPase inhibitor ouabain (1 mM). Spontaneous or K+-evoked α-MSH release was
